[QUOTE="royinidaho, post: 318643, member: 2011"] That'll make a difference! Formula for determining LOH over LOB. Distance from top of end bell to bottom of barrel minus ((1/2 of scope end bell diameter) plus (1/2 of barrel diameter at front of scope end bell)) All measured at the same point. If there is a sloped base then some fudging be necessary. With the new LOS value and the old atmos data here's what I what I came up with.
